在日常生活中,我们经常需要计算两个日期之间的天数差异,比如统计假期天数、计算账单周期等。传统的计算方法往往需要手动计算,既耗时又容易出错。今天,就让我来为大家介绍一些巧用小技巧,轻松计算两个日期之间的天数差异,让你告别繁琐的计算过程!
1. 利用Excel函数计算天数差异
如果你使用的是Excel表格,那么计算两个日期之间的天数差异就非常简单了。Excel提供了DAYS函数,可以直接计算出两个日期之间的天数差异。
代码示例:
=DAYS("2023-01-01", "2023-01-10")
解释:
DAYS函数的第一个参数是开始日期,第二个参数是结束日期。- 函数返回两个日期之间的天数差异。
2. 使用Python的datetime模块
如果你是编程爱好者,可以使用Python的datetime模块来计算两个日期之间的天数差异。
代码示例:
from datetime import datetime
start_date = datetime.strptime("2023-01-01", "%Y-%m-%d")
end_date = datetime.strptime("2023-01-10", "%Y-%m-%d")
days_difference = (end_date - start_date).days
print(days_difference)
解释:
datetime.strptime函数用于将字符串格式的日期转换为datetime对象。end_date - start_date计算两个日期之间的时间差。.days属性返回时间差的天数。
3. 利用在线日期计算器
如果你不想使用Excel或编程,也可以利用在线日期计算器来轻松计算两个日期之间的天数差异。只需输入开始日期和结束日期,即可得到结果。
4. 手动计算天数差异
当然,如果你不想依赖工具,也可以手动计算两个日期之间的天数差异。以下是一些计算方法:
- 按月计算:将两个日期分别转换为月份和天数,然后计算月份之间的差异,最后将天数相加。
- 按年计算:将两个日期分别转换为年份和月份,然后计算年份之间的差异,最后将月份和天数相加。
- 按星期计算:将两个日期分别转换为星期和天数,然后计算星期之间的差异,最后将天数相加。
总结
通过以上方法,你可以轻松计算两个日期之间的天数差异。在实际应用中,可以根据自己的需求选择合适的方法。希望这些小技巧能帮助你提高工作效率,节省时间!
